UFC on ESPN 52: Dariush vs Tsarukyan 4-fight parlay

UFC on ESPN 52 takes place on Saturday at the Moody Center in Austin, Texas. This card features a lightweight fight between Beneil Dariush and Arman Tsarukyan as the Main Event.

Beneil Dariush vs. Arman Tsarukyan – Fight to go the Distance – No (-165)

Beneil Dariush comes into this fight with an MMA record of 22-5-1 and 16-5-1 in the UFC. Dariush is averaging 3.79 significant strikes per minute and he has a striking accuracy of 49%. He is absorbing 2.63 strikes and has a striking defense of 58%. As for his grappling, Dariush has also been solid. He is averaging 1.91 takedowns per every 15 minutes and 0.9 submission attempts during the same time period.

Arman Tsarukyan comes into this fight with an MMA record of 20-3 and 7-2 in the UFC. Tsarukyan is averaging 3.82 significant strikes per minute and has a striking accuracy of 48%. He is absorbing 1.91 strikes and has a striking defense of 54%. His grappling has been elite so far, averaging 3.43 takedowns per every 15 minutes.

Tsarukyan is a heavy favorite in this fight, therefore backing his money line is too risky. Instead, we will be looking for this fight to end inside the distance. Dariush has seen 18 of his 28 career fights end inside the distance, while Tsarukyan has seen 14 of his 23 career fights do the same. Because both fighters have a high finish rate, backing this fight to end inside the distance will be our play.

Jalin Turner vs. Bobby Green – Fight to go the Distance – No (-165)

Jalin Turner is the clear favorite in this fight, so instead of backing either side to win, we will focus on this fight to end by finish. Bobby Green has seen 26 of his 46 career fights end by finish, which includes his last 4 fights in a row. Turner has seen 16 of his 20 career fights end inside the distance, which includes 5 of his last 7 fights. Because both guys have had a high finish rate recently, backing this fight to end inside the distance will be our play.

Clay Guida vs. Joaquim Silva – Fight to go the Distance – No (-175)

Joaquim Silva is a significant favorite, but looking for this fight to end inside the distance looks to be the better option. Clay Guida has seen 36 of his 61 career fights end inside the distance, while Silva has seen 13 of his 16 career fights do the same, which includes his last 5 fights in a row. Because both guys have an above average finish rate, backing this fight to end inside the distance will be our play.

Punahele Soriano vs. Dustin Stoltzfus – Over 1.5 Rounds (-150)

Punahele Soriano is the heavy favorite in this fight, making his money line too risky. Instead, we will be targeting this fight to go over 1.5 rounds. Dustin Stoltzfus has seen 4 of his last 5 fights go over 1.5 rounds, while 3 of Soriano’s last 4 fights have done the same. Because they both have been able to last at least a couple of rounds in their recent fights, backing this fight to go over 1.5 rounds will be our play.
